如何在即时通讯管理系统中实现语音转文字?
在当今数字化时代,即时通讯管理系统已成为人们日常生活中不可或缺的一部分。然而,在沟通中,语音信息往往比文字信息更加直接、生动。那么,如何在即时通讯管理系统中实现语音转文字功能呢?本文将为您详细解析。
语音转文字技术概述
语音转文字技术,即语音识别技术,是指将语音信号转换为文字的过程。这项技术已经广泛应用于智能语音助手、车载导航、会议记录等领域。在即时通讯管理系统中,语音转文字功能能够提高沟通效率,降低沟通成本,提升用户体验。
实现语音转文字的步骤
采集语音信号:首先,需要采集用户的语音信号。这可以通过即时通讯软件自带的麦克风或第三方语音采集设备实现。
语音预处理:将采集到的语音信号进行预处理,包括降噪、去噪、增强等操作,以提高语音质量。
语音识别:将预处理后的语音信号输入到语音识别引擎中,将其转换为文字。目前,市面上主流的语音识别引擎有百度语音、科大讯飞、腾讯云等。
文字处理:对识别出的文字进行进一步处理,包括去除错别字、标点符号等,确保文字的准确性。
文字输出:将处理后的文字输出到即时通讯管理系统中,供用户查看。
案例分析
以某知名即时通讯软件为例,该软件在实现语音转文字功能时,采用了以下策略:
与主流语音识别引擎合作:该软件与百度语音、科大讯飞等主流语音识别引擎合作,确保语音识别的准确性。
优化语音采集设备:该软件在手机端优化了麦克风采集设备,提高了语音采集质量。
智能降噪技术:在语音预处理阶段,该软件采用了智能降噪技术,有效降低了环境噪声对语音识别的影响。
实时反馈:在语音识别过程中,该软件提供了实时反馈功能,用户可以随时查看识别结果。
通过以上措施,该即时通讯软件成功实现了语音转文字功能,受到了广大用户的喜爱。
总结
在即时通讯管理系统中实现语音转文字功能,需要结合先进的语音识别技术、高效的语音采集设备和智能化的处理策略。通过不断优化和改进,语音转文字功能将为用户提供更加便捷、高效的沟通体验。
猜你喜欢:智慧医疗系统